补充资料:临界阻尼系数
分子式:
CAS号:
性质:由质量、弹簧和黏性阻尼组成的单自由度振动系统中,当阻尼系数增大至某一临界值,系统就会出现不发生自由振动的状态,在该临界伏态下的阻尼系数称为临界阻尼系数,临界阻尼系数Cc可由式求得:Cc=,式中,m为材料质量;k为弹簧常数。
